    Could be spybots not helping

    Turn off Spybots 'TEA TIMER' mode ~
    Open Spybot
    Change Mode (Top) to ADVANCED
    Select TOOLS then RESIDENT
    UNTICK 'Resident TEA TIMER' (Leave 'SD Helper' TICKED)
